This essential workshop is designed to demystify the Goods and Services Tax (GST) audit process and empower businesses with the knowledge to ensure compliance. Participants will gain a clear understanding of why and how the Inland Revenue Authority of Singapore (IRAS) conducts audits, including the legal framework and potential penalties for non-compliance. The session moves beyond theory to provide practical, actionable insights into the most common errors identified by IRAS, helping businesses to identify and rectify vulnerabilities in their own GST reporting processes.
Beyond identifying risks, the workshop focuses on proactive and reactive strategies. It equips attendees with preventive measures to strengthen their internal controls and filing procedures, thereby reducing the likelihood of an audit. Furthermore, it outlines the necessary corrective actions to take if discrepancies are found, using real-world case studies to illustrate common pitfalls and the practical application of GST laws. This program is a crucial step for any business seeking to navigate the complexities of GST with confidence.
